- One of the University’s distinguished scholars has concluded his service with meritorious distinction. The 44th Valedictorian, Prof. Lucky Akaruese of the Department of Philosophy, delivered a compelling lecture titled “The Philosopher and the Social Space: A Panorama from Socrates to Akaruese”. In his address, he emphasized that philosophy has never been neutral; rather, it has always been engaged in struggles—against complacency, injustice, and silence—highlighting the enduring role of philosophers in shaping society. We wish him happy retirement in good health
- The University of Port Harcourt Senate, at its emergency meeting held on Wednesday, 4th March 2025, at the CBN Centre of Excellence Auditorium, elected Profs. Tobinson Briggs and Chinedu Ogbuji to represent the interests of the University Senate on the Joint Selection Board of Council and Senate. Additionally, Profs. Faith Aminikpo and Chidiebere Ugwu were appointed to serve on the Search Team for the selection of a substantive Vice-Chancellor.
- In continuation of this process, the University of Port Harcourt Congregation has elected Prof. Hope Kagbo and Mrs. Otami Akubom as its representatives on the Search Team for the appointment of a substantive Vice-Chancellor

- We received state-of-the-art laboratory equipment to enhance teaching and research in the Department of Civil and Environmental Engineering, Faculty of Engineering,.The equipment—including a Hydrocarbon Spectrometer, Atomic Absorption Spectrometer, and Flame Photometer, etc were graciously donated by the Federal Government of Nigeria through the Federal Ministry of Regional Development. We once again convey our deep appreciation to the administration of President Bola Ahmed Tinubu for this thoughtful intervention. We also urge the department to ensure the effective utilization and proper maintenance of the donated equipment in order to maximize its benefits for teaching, learning, and research
